C. PUBLIC FORUM:
Marilyn Schweitzer shared her concerns regarding accessibility of the
Riverwalk and the 2031 Master Plan South Gateway project as they relate
to the proposed plans for incorporating 10 Martin Avenue into the Edward
Hospital Campus. An email addressing her concerns, along with diagrams
of the area, were distributed and are attached to these minutes. She is
concerned with the poor connectivity to the Riverwalk and lack of
accessibility.
Novack provided background on the property at the southwest corner of
Martin Avenue and Washington Street. Ryan Companies is proposing to
demolish the existing building and build a new facility that Edward Hospital
will be utilizing. Novack noted that after initially seeing the plans, City staff
informed the developer that there needed to be a sidewalk along the new
entrance up from Martin Avenue to allow barrier-free pedestrian access.
He apologized that the developer did not update the drawings to reflect this
at the last Planning and Zoning Commission meeting. Discussion followed
on suggestions to improve the accessibility with Erickson suggesting
signage. Novack thanked Schweitzer for her comments and for bringing

4. Fredenhagen Park Fountain - Bill Novack
Novack reported that plans are almost complete and are being reviewed
by Development Services before going out to bid for the fountain repair.
City Council has requested that the Commission review this further to
discuss alternatives for potentially replacing the fountain with a less high
dollar maintenance item. Discussion followed on the Exchange Club
Memories Fountain, the importance of their funding and the donor
contributions tied to the fountain. Hitchcock provided background on the
original development of the area and the importance of the community’s
access to the property and this focal point. It was suggested and agreed
that the Exchange Club be brought into the conversation, along with Tom,
Sue, and Jody Castagnoli. The possibility of engaging the Riverwalk
consultant to come up with alternatives such as sculpture, LED light fixtures
or a simpler water feature was also suggested. Erickson will reach out to
the parties and there will be follow up at next month’s meeting.

8. South Extension preliminary design discussion - Carl Peterson
Peterson reviewed the most recent drawings with the group and advised of
suggestions that were made to date. Discussion followed on the
importance of the bicycle path and getting to Martin Avenue. Peterson is
looking for feedback regarding the utilities, the use of the existing sidewalk
for bicycling, what features should be included in the plan, and if there are
any improvements planned for the intersection at West Martin Avenue and
Washington Street to reflect the new gateway. Novack noted the projected
timeline for the project would consist of preliminary design being
developed in 2022, permitting and final design in 2023, and construction
beginning in 2024 or 2025. Hitchcock added the importance of exploring a
wider, dual purpose path or a separate leg of the path for bicycles even
though the DuPage River trail is located on the other side of the river. He
also expressed concern with building the path too close to the river
because of the elimination of trees and privacy for existing residents.
Novack brought up a previous discussion about creating separate paths for
pedestrians and cyclists. Additional suggestions were discussed and
Peterson will provide updated concepts based on these discussions at the
next meeting.
